Kaita's artificial brain is designed in such a fashion that'd be hard for Beth to just hack like a normal computer. Her frontal lobe works on artificial neurons that create thoughts, behaviors, and impulses that are then regulated by another component that works like the brain stem and cerebellum. Effectively, every part of her could technically work as a prosthetic version of its organic counterpart, including the brain, so you'd need to know how to "hack" human impulses in order to even begin to say, overwrite who she is.
However, the wolf also has a more mundane smartphone chip installed on her that her brain can directly use at the speed of thought that allows her to interface with other devices, and is easy to replace or upgrade without messing with the brain itself. Think like a simple computer with linux or a stripped down Android OS that your brain is hooked up to that it can mess with in any way it wants, to make calls or save memes or something, while the phone can't do anything to the brain besides sending signals to the optic and audio feeds.
Beth likewise is an AI designed to only exist physically as a chip on her own phone. This phone is installed on Kaita in a similar fashion to the wolf's own on-board smartphone, through which Kaita can talk privately to Beth and see the AI do stupid shit on her HUD. Like, a more bitchy Cortana. Beth doesn't like wasting power or always being seen, so she usually only peeks out when she feels like it in the first place. She very often is just a voice or, if she's feeling nonverbal, a series of dialogue boxes Kaita sees as notifications from her phone's OS.
In terms of possession, there's technically a workaround; her hardlight body can produce electrical signals, and if she was really desperate and persistent could sort of jam her projected form onto Kaita's brain stem that way, but it'd be very very taxing to pull off unless Kaita for some reason allows Beth to do it, usually only as an agreed upon emergency measure if the wolf is incapacitated/deeply unconscious.
The picture above basically only happens because Kaita trusts Beth not to do something stupid. She's probably a bit mentally tired from something, and is letting Beth take control so she can "rest" a little. It only takes a little bit of mental effort on Kaita's part to eject Beth, but Beth lacks a physical body and sometimes Kaita feels a bit bad for the AI, so she lets her have some fun if it also means getting someone else to do a few menial tasks for her for once.

To everyone making New Years Resolutions right now:
Please consider making it a resolution to create accessible content.
[Plain Text: Please consider making it a resolution to create accessible content.]
When you make art, consider making an image description and/or alt text to go with it.
When you share videos, consider adding captions or subtitles.
When you post memes or just images in general, consider adding image descriptions/alt text to them.
There is so much content out there but so little of it is actually accessible. It doesn't take much time at all to make it accessible, either. Especially since there's already resources and softwares out there to get you started.
This link discusses the differences between alt text and image descriptions as well as how to create them on Tumblr (Note: Some info is outdated. Alt text can now be added/edited after the image is posted).
If you don't want to make captions yourself, I've heard good things about Hitpaw Edimakor. You can also use apps such as LiveTranscibe on Android and even Google Docs has a function for turning audio into text.
Even if you won't make alt text or captions or whatnot yourself, just taking a look through the reblogs of a post to find an accessible version is helpful.
Just make sure to double check any content before sharing it as many people will add alt text to images as a joke, meme, or just as a way to include more information about the image (Rather than as actual alt text). This goes double if you're using AI or other softwares to transcribe/describe/otherwise make content accessible.
Now go forth and make shit accessible!
